![]() Almost new production 7.62x39 today is of the M67 lead core type, so it's not fair to compare the 5.45x39 to the older M43 round. Many advocates of the 5.45x39 round completely ignore the earlier yawing M67 round and talk about the less lethal original M43 steel core loading, which has a tendency to leave the body before any yaw occured.
